Global travel management agency The ATPI Group has announced it has joined forces with Direct Travel, a provider of corporate travel management services, to form DIRECT ATPI Global Travel.
This new brand and union was solidified through reciprocal, equal investments between both companies.

A joint governing board and leadership structure has already begun managing the new entity’s day-to-day operations, maximising potential and ensuring seamless service to multinational corporate clients.
ATPI will operate as such in its locations around the world and will continue to run its specialised Sports Events and Energy and Shipping divisions separately.
Direct Travel will continue to operate under its existing brand in the US, and Vision Travel, which joined forces with Direct Travel earlier this year, will similarly operate in Canada under its existing brand.
Graham Ramsey, chairman, the ATPI Group, explains the new organisation formed between the ATPI Group and Direct Travel fits with a long term strategy of continued growth in the North America market.
Together, the ATPI Group and Direct Travel represent over $7bn in sales, having 160+ locations in more than 50 countries, and draw upon over 4,500 team members worldwide to service clients.
